As with the clearer drawing on the recto (D22461), this appears to be a single standing female figure, but the outline here is slight and disrupted by offsetting. For other figure studies in this sketchbook, see under folio 1 verso (D22324).
Technical notes:
There is heavy offsetting from the paste-down and staining from the leather overlaps beneath it inside the back cover opposite (D41057).
